**Handover — Velta cache postmortem**

To whoever picks this up: the stale-cache bug hit Velta's pricing endpoint twice last quarter. Root cause was TTLs set longer than the upstream refresh window, so clients saw prices up to six hours old. Postmortem doc is in the Orrin wiki; action items half done. Eviction logic now keys on upstream version, not wall clock. Don't touch the warmer job until the follow-up lands. Current production settings, for reference, are listed below.

config for kagup-hahig:
druwyn:
  pin: 2801
  metrics_host: metrics.druwyn.zemvarlabs.internal
  tenant: sorius
  seal: seal_798a43d7

The Nightshade dark-mode work for the Corvid Admin Dashboard requires a full local environment, since theme tokens are resolved server-side per tenant. Clone the repo, install dependencies with `fernpack install`, and copy `env.sample` to your local env file. Before starting the dev server, verify that the theme-token seed migration has been applied; otherwise every tenant falls back to light mode and the toggle appears disabled. Migrations run against the tenant settings database, which you can reach with the connection string below.

warehouse DSN: mssql://rusdor_svc:0FSWCn9@db-951a.paliqforge.local:5432/ulawyn

Subject: Quota cut-over complete

Hi — confirming the per-tenant rate quota cut-over on Meterfall finished at 02:10 with no rollback triggers hit. All tenants were migrated to the new quota engine in four batches, each verified against shadow traffic before promotion. Two tenants briefly exceeded their ceilings during batch three; both recovered automatically. No support escalations so far. For your records, the production quota service now runs with the following configuration.

deployment values, yagaf-fafog:
ULAAX_PIN=0316
ULAAX_METRICS_HOST=metrics.ulaax.paliqworks.internal
ULAAX_LOG_LEVEL=error
ULAAX_TENANT=rusael